I am having trouble including a bibliography in a knitr child document.  I want to be able to reference articles from my main bibliography in a child document, but have the bibliography appear after the main document, not after the child.  If I only include the \bibliography command in the main document, the references in the child document are not parsed correctly.  Example: 
main.Rnw:
\documentclass[10pt,a4paper]{article}
\usepackage[utf8]{inputenc}
\begin{document}
This is the main doc.
<<child-demo, child='child.Rnw'>>=
@
\bibliography{mylib}
\end{document}
child.Rnw:
This is the child \cite{myref}.
mylib.bib:
@article{myref,
 title = {frobnosticating froo filters}
 volume = {21},
 journal = {Frobnification},
 author = {John Q. Smith}
 month = jan,
 year = {2004}
}
My compile script contains: 
#!/usr/bin/env Rscript
library(knitr)
knit('main.Rnw', tangle=TRUE)
knit('main.Rnw', tangle=FALSE)
for ( i in c(1,2,3)) {
  system('pdflatex main')
  system('bibtex main')
}
Running compile produces: 

How can I make the child document include references from the main bibliography?
